Many people notice slower recovery from workouts over time. Experts confirm factors like aging, stress, and training intensity contribute, but some causes remain unclear. This matters for optimizing fitness routines and health.
Many individuals are experiencing longer recovery times after workouts than in the past, prompting questions about underlying causes. Experts confirm factors such as aging, stress, and training intensity play roles, but some reasons remain uncertain. This trend matters because understanding recovery is essential for optimizing fitness and preventing injury.
Recovery from exercise involves complex physiological processes, including muscle repair, glycogen replenishment, and hormonal regulation. Recent data shows an increase in online searches related to slower recovery, indicating a widespread concern. Experts confirm that age-related changes, increased stress levels, and training intensity are significant contributors to this phenomenon.
According to sports medicine specialists, as people age, their bodies naturally recover more slowly due to declines in muscle mass, hormone production, and cellular repair mechanisms. Additionally, higher stress levels—whether from work, sleep deprivation, or mental health issues—can impair recovery by elevating cortisol and other stress hormones. Increased training intensity or frequency without adequate rest can also lead to prolonged soreness and fatigue.
However, some causes remain unclear. For instance, the precise impact of lifestyle factors such as diet, hydration, and sleep quality on recovery rates is still being studied. Moreover, individual differences in genetics and underlying health conditions may influence recovery, but these variables are not yet fully understood or accounted for in general advice.
Implications of Slower Recovery for Fitness and Health
This trend has practical implications for anyone engaging in regular physical activity. Slower recovery can increase the risk of injury, overtraining, and burnout if not managed properly. It may also affect motivation and consistency, impacting long-term fitness goals. Understanding the confirmed causes allows individuals to adapt their routines, prioritize recovery strategies, and seek medical advice when necessary.
Furthermore, recognizing that recovery slows with age and stress underscores the importance of personalized training plans, adequate rest, and holistic health management. For fitness professionals, this highlights the need to tailor programs that account for these factors, especially for older clients or those under significant stress.

Known Factors Influencing Post-Workout Recovery
Recovery from exercise has long been understood as a multifaceted process involving muscle repair, glycogen restoration, and hormonal balance. It is well established that aging leads to physiological changes, including decreased muscle mass and hormone production, which slow recovery. Stress, both physical and psychological, can elevate cortisol levels, impairing tissue repair and immune function. Training intensity and frequency are also known to influence recovery times, with overtraining leading to prolonged soreness and fatigue.
Recent interest in this topic appears to be driven by increased online searches and discussions, although the exact trigger remains unconfirmed. Experts note that lifestyle factors such as sleep, diet, and hydration also play roles, but their specific impacts are still under investigation. This ongoing inquiry reflects a broader concern about maintaining optimal fitness as people age and face increasing stressors.

Key Questions
Why do I feel more sore after workouts than before?
This could be due to increased training intensity, aging, or stress levels. It is advisable to adjust your routine and ensure proper rest and nutrition.
Can stress really affect my workout recovery?
Yes, elevated stress hormones like cortisol can impair muscle repair and immune function, leading to slower recovery.
Should I see a doctor if recovery continues to be slow?
If prolonged soreness or fatigue persists despite adjustments, consulting a healthcare professional is recommended to rule out underlying health issues.
Are there specific foods or supplements that can help recovery?
A balanced diet rich in protein, antioxidants, and hydration supports recovery, but individual needs vary. Consult a nutritionist for personalized advice.
Is this slowdown in recovery permanent?
Recovery rates can improve with lifestyle changes, proper training, and stress management. It is not necessarily a permanent decline but a sign to adjust your approach.
